Irish Soda Bread



4 cups all-purpose flour

4 tablespoons white sugar

1 teaspoon baking soda

1 tablespoon baking powder

1/2 teaspoon salt

1/2 cup butter, softened

1 cup buttermilk

1 egg, beaten



butter

buttermilk



1. Preheat oven to 375ºF. Lightly grease a large baking sheet.



2. Mix together the first 5 ingredients. Cut butter into flour

mixture until combined.



3. Stir in buttermilk and egg.



4. Turn dough out onto a lightly floured surface and knead slightly.



5. Form dough into a round and place on prepared baking sheet.



6. In a small bowl, combine 1/4 cup melted butter with 1/4 cup of

buttermilk; brush loaf with this mixture. Use a sharp knife to cut

an 'X' into the top of the loaf.



7. Bake for 40-50 minutes, or until a toothpick inserted into the

center
of the loaf comes out clean. Brush the loaf with the butter

mixture a couple of times while it bakes.
